🧍‍♂️ The Human Behind the Uniform

Security guards are often perceived as “just standing there.” But what we don’t always see is their training, vigilance, and readiness to act in times of crisis. Many guards are trained in:

  1. Emergency response

  2. First aid and CPR

  3. Conflict de-escalation

  4. Customer service and communication

These aren’t skills you learn overnight. They take dedication, discipline, and heart.

Just like doctors, teachers, or police officers, security guards are essential workers—often working long shifts, holidays, and night hours to make sure everyone else feels secure. 💬 Why Respect Matters

Respect isn’t just a feeling—it’s a behavior. And how we treat security personnel reflects who we are as a society. Here’s why showing respect to security guards matters:

1. They Protect Without Recognition

Guards are often the first responders in unexpected situations—fights, medical emergencies, break-ins, or fires. They often act before the police or EMTs arrive, but their efforts rarely make headlines.

2. They Create Safe Environments

A professional security guard doesn't just respond to threats—they prevent them. Their presence alone reduces crime, increases order, and encourages responsible behavior in public spaces.

3. They Serve With Dignity

Many security guards come from diverse backgrounds—veterans, immigrants, students, retirees. Regardless of where they come from, they deserve the same dignity and appreciation as anyone else working to keep people safe.

🙌 How You Can Show Respect

Respecting security guards doesn't require grand gestures. Sometimes, the simplest actions go the furthest:

  1. Make eye contact and say hello

  2. Follow their instructions without resistance

  3. Avoid dismissive or condescending language

  4. Thank them for their service

These basic acts of kindness contribute to a more respectful, connected, and human-centered community.
